Ownership group

Per CMS filings, this facility is affiliated with Crown Healthcare Group, a group operating 9 facilities in 1 states. Group record: average rating 2.3/5, 1 abuse citation icons, 0 facilities on the Special Focus list, $334,577 in federal fines. This facility rates below its group average (2.3/5).

Staffing (hours per resident per day)

Total nurse staffing: 2.99 (Ohio median: 3.57). RN hours: 0.37. Weekend total: 2.83. Nursing staff turnover: 59%.

Inspection deficiencies

All-time on record: 63 deficiency citations, including 2 at immediate-jeopardy level. Below: citations from 2023 onward (severity letters explained in methodology).
